Topic: Detection of magnetic objects using gradient methods

Short description of topic:
Measurement methods using magnetic gradient are useful in many application areas, including detection of vehicles, detection of metallic objects (arms, unexploded ordnance), perimeter protection, geomagnetic data cleaning and
denoising, etc.
Much of current research worldwide is focused on advanced data processing of full tensor magnetic data and/or higher gradient tensor data e.g. for improved target positioning estimation. Our research shall focus on improving positioning
estimation accuracy and reliability.
